How to grow Guanyin lotus in summer

How to grow Guanyin lotus in summer

soil

The Alocasia odora likes a loose soil environment, and the soil must be better in terms of nutrients, drainage and air permeability. But it doesn't mean that this kind of soil is hard to find. First, go to the fields or grasslands to dig some ordinary soil, then pick up some rotten leaves in the woods to make organic natural fertilizer, and add some gravel. illumination

Now let's talk about how the Alocasia odora should deal with the length of light during its summer dormancy period. Because its leaves are very delicate, high temperature exposure will inevitably lead to water loss, resulting in a listless and lifeless appearance. Therefore, during the hot summer season, you should let your Alocasia odora escape from the environment of high-intensity direct sunlight. Generally, an environment with low light or diffuse light is the best, which is most conducive to the Alocasia odora to survive the hot summer. Have you learned it? Moisture

The growing season of the Alocasia odora is generally in spring and autumn when the climate is suitable. At this time, I believe everyone naturally knows that they should water it more. The general judgment is based on the surface dryness of the soil in the flowerpot. If it is dry and a layer of white substance appears, it means that you should water your Alocasia odora quickly. However, in summer, the Alocasia odora enters a dormant period and no longer continues to grow, so do not water it too much even if the evaporation is high, otherwise it will be soaked and the roots will rot.
